I am a modeling and simulation engineer at Idaho National Laboratory, working primarily on Integrated Energy Systems. Current research endeavors include code development for energy dispatch optimization in hybrid nuclear and renewable energy systems. I have worked as a postdoctoral researcher at the University of Wisconsin-Madison with Dr. Ben Lindley, investigating optimal dispatch strategies for lead-cooled fast reactors with thermal energy storage. Additional case studies were conducted for coupling with concentrated solar power plants. I received my PhD from Cornell University working under the guidance of Prof. Dmitry Savransky. My thesis explored astrodynamic simulations of exoplanet-finding missions, particularly in optimizing fuel usage and improving science yields from observing schedules.
